There is a significant gap in the cost of living between these two cities. Jim Falls is 18.2% cheaper than Van Dyne. With a cost index of 77 vs 94, the difference would have a meaningful impact on a household's monthly budget. Someone relocating from Jim Falls to Van Dyne should plan for substantially higher expenses across most categories.

When it comes to buying, median home values in Jim Falls are $188,200 compared to $265,700 in Van Dyne, a 29% gap.

Median household income in Jim Falls is $103,250 compared to $119,107 in Van Dyne (-13.3%). The higher salaries in Van Dyne partially offset the cost difference, but don't fully close the gap.
